  • My hubby set up GroupCal for us to use. It’s great as you can set it up for multiple members, i.e. hubby and I both have the app and are both able to see the same calendar. If either of us adds an appointment or event, the other member gets a notification instantly on their phone, so everyone is kept in the loop.


  • We use the Family Wall app, it’s free. It links all our phones together with an Invite, can colour code kids sports and appointments for each person. Everyone gets a notification when an entry is made or adjusted. It’s been really easy to use even my teenage son adds in his sporting events and physio appointments without our help.

  • A close family friend of mine recommended Cozi Family Organiser. She has teenage kids and coparents so uses it to manage sporting commitments, the custody calender, when kids are working, etc. She said there are lots of ads but it is good in that you have all the info in the same place and it’s simple to use and colour coded.
